aboutsummaryrefslogtreecommitdiff
path: root/package.json
diff options
context:
space:
mode:
authorXhmikosR <[email protected]>2017-10-03 06:34:56 +0300
committerMark Otto <[email protected]>2017-10-02 20:34:56 -0700
commit7b766e1ad53b0c22de42dac04d2472f287334e2a (patch)
treec5e869bdfda6e10628c83758bab3c238e5a48b98 /package.json
parentf58997a0dae54dc98d11892afef9acb85bdc6a1e (diff)
downloadbootstrap-7b766e1ad53b0c22de42dac04d2472f287334e2a.tar.xz
bootstrap-7b766e1ad53b0c22de42dac04d2472f287334e2a.zip
Switch to stylelint. (#23572)
Diffstat (limited to 'package.json')
-rw-r--r--package.json13
1 files changed, 8 insertions, 5 deletions
diff --git a/package.json b/package.json
index 48bbb7668..3a123a78e 100644
--- a/package.json
+++ b/package.json
@@ -22,10 +22,10 @@
"css": "npm-run-all --parallel css-lint* css-compile* --sequential css-prefix* css-minify*",
"css-main": "npm-run-all --parallel css-lint css-compile --sequential css-prefix css-minify",
"css-docs": "npm-run-all --parallel css-lint-docs css-compile-docs --sequential css-prefix-docs css-minify-docs",
- "css-lint": "bundle exec scss-lint --config .scss-lint.yml scss/*.scss",
- "css-lint-docs": "bundle exec scss-lint --config .scss-lint.yml --exclude assets/scss/docs.scss assets/scss/*.scss",
"css-compile": "node-sass --output-style expanded --source-map true --source-map-contents true --precision 6 scss/bootstrap.scss dist/css/bootstrap.css && node-sass --output-style expanded --source-map true --source-map-contents true --precision 6 scss/bootstrap-grid.scss dist/css/bootstrap-grid.css && node-sass --output-style expanded --source-map true --source-map-contents true --precision 6 scss/bootstrap-reboot.scss dist/css/bootstrap-reboot.css",
"css-compile-docs": "node-sass --output-style expanded --source-map true --source-map-contents true --precision 6 assets/scss/docs.scss assets/css/docs.min.css",
+ "css-lint": "stylelint --config build/.stylelintrc --syntax scss scss/**/*.scss",
+ "css-lint-docs": "stylelint --config build/.stylelintrc --syntax scss assets/scss/*.scss",
"css-prefix": "postcss --config build/postcss.config.js --replace dist/css/*.css",
"css-prefix-docs": "postcss --config build/postcss.config.js --no-map --replace assets/css/docs.min.css",
"css-minify": "cleancss --level 1 --source-map --source-map-inline-sources --output dist/css/bootstrap.min.css dist/css/bootstrap.css && cleancss --level 1 --source-map --source-map-inline-sources --output dist/css/bootstrap-grid.min.css dist/css/bootstrap-grid.css && cleancss --level 1 --source-map --source-map-inline-sources --output dist/css/bootstrap-reboot.min.css dist/css/bootstrap-reboot.css",
@@ -105,6 +105,11 @@
"rollup-plugin-node-resolve": "^3.0.0",
"shelljs": "^0.7.8",
"shx": "^0.2.2",
+ "stylelint": "^8.1.1",
+ "stylelint-config-recommended-scss": "^2.0.0",
+ "stylelint-config-standard": "^17.0.0",
+ "stylelint-order": "^0.7.0",
+ "stylelint-scss": "^2.1.0",
"uglify-js": "^3.0.24",
"workbox-build": "^2.0.1"
},
@@ -119,9 +124,7 @@
"build",
"js/.eslintrc.json",
"js/**/*.js",
- ".scss-lint.yml",
- "scss/**/*.scss",
- "LICENSE"
+ "scss/**/*.scss"
],
"browserslist": [
"Chrome >= 45",